[solved] Grub Legacy freezing while loading vmlinuz26

I tried to install ArchLinux using the standard (Grub-based) FTP ISO image (i686), but the boot process would always freeze at the same point (just after leaving the initial Grub screen).

So I tried the isolinux-based FTP ISO (x86_64), and it worked.

After booting the newly installed system, the same freezing problem happened, at the exact same point as before.

I went to Grub's command line (by typing 'c') and tried this:

grub> fstest
Filesystem tracing is now on

grub> root (hd0,0)
Filesystem type is ext2fs, partition type 0x83

grub> kernel /vmlinuz26 root=/dev/sda7 ro
[7401,0,10][7401,0,512][7402,0,512], (...) [7416,0,512]   [Linux-bzImage, setup=0x3600, size=0x1c4980]
[7417,0,512][7418,0,512], (...) [7431,0,512][7432,0,512]

At this point, the system hangs.

Re: [solved] Grub Legacy freezing while loading vmlinuz26

It seems to be a known incompatibility between Dell OptiPlex 320 machines and Grub legacy.

Re: [solved] Grub Legacy freezing while loading vmlinuz26

To be able to boot, I had to boot using the installation CD and then install Grub 2, like this:

mkdir /mnt/local
mount /dev/sda7 /mnt/local

cd /mnt/local
pacman --root . --cachedir var/cache/pacman/pkg --dbpath var/lib/pacman -S grub2

mount -t proc none /mnt/local/proc
mount -o bind /dev/ /mnt/local/dev
chroot /mnt/local /bin/bash

grub-install /dev/sda
